Vet aa claim/flag won't be lost in your scenario, but you will only have as many vet aa as the target account is eligible for (not necessarily the same number as you have now on the pally). https://help.daybreakgames.com/hc/en-us/articles/230627407-EverQuest-Character-Transfer-Instructions "Characters that have been flagged to receive Veteran Rewards maintain this flag, however, as these rewards are based on the age of the account, your character may gain or lose abilities depending upon the Veteran Reward level of the account the character has been moved to."
